Abstract

The utility model is used for the technical field of vegetable planting, disclose a kind of vegetable seeding device with adjustable spacing, including power self-propelled frame, the lower end of the one side of power self-propelled frame is fixedly connected with mounting bracket, the outside surface of mounting bracket is evenly provided with positioning hole, and the outer surface of mounting bracket is fixedly installed with displacement wheel.The vegetable seeding device with adjustable spacing, device is cooperated with mounting bracket with positioning hole by the function frame of slidable, so that the position of sower relative to power self-propelled frame can be adjusted horizontally, this design allows user to change seeding row spacing flexibly according to the agronomic requirement of different vegetable varieties, effectively solve the problem that traditional seeding device row spacing is fixed and poor adaptability, the clamping connection mode of locking plate, locking column and positioning hole, simple and reliable structure, can ensure that function frame is firmly locked during operation, guarantee the stability of row spacing and seeding accuracy.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of vegetable planting technology, specifically to a vegetable sowing device with adjustable spacing. Background Technology

[0002] Vegetable sowing is a crucial link in agricultural production, and its efficiency and quality are directly related to vegetable yield and planting benefits. With the development of agricultural mechanization, traditional manual sowing methods have been gradually replaced by various sowing machines due to their low efficiency and high labor intensity. In existing technologies, vegetable sowing devices usually consist of a power mechanism, a sowing unit, a furrow opener, and a soil covering device, but they still have many shortcomings in terms of adaptability, precision, and stability. Currently, common seeding devices use scoops to sow single seeds or a fixed number of seeds. However, in actual use, the vibration generated by the machine's movement can easily cause the seeds in the scoop to fall out, resulting in uneven sowing amount and inconsistent density, which affects the quality of seedling emergence. In addition, different vegetable varieties have significantly different requirements for seed size and sowing spacing, but existing seeding devices mostly use fixed-size seed troughs or sowing trays, which are difficult to flexibly adapt to various crops. If the capacity of the sowing trough is not adjustable, it will lead to small seeds being sown too densely or large seeds being sown sparsely, which not only wastes seeds but may also reduce yield due to competition between seedlings or missing seedlings in the rows. In summary, current vegetable planting devices urgently need to address the issue of poor adjustability of planting spacing in order to adapt to diverse planting needs. Utility Model Content

[0003] The purpose of this invention is to provide a vegetable sowing device with adjustable spacing to solve the problem of poor sowing spacing adjustability mentioned in the background art.

[0004]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a vegetable sowing device with adjustable spacing, comprising a powered self-propelled frame, a mounting frame fixedly connected to the lower end of one side of the powered self-propelled frame, positioning holes evenly provided on the outer surface of the mounting frame, displacement wheels fixedly mounted on the outer surface of the mounting frame, and a sliding functional frame mounted on the outer surface of the mounting frame, a transmission rod fixedly connected to the power output end of the powered self-propelled frame, one end of the transmission rod penetrating the outer surface of the functional frame, and a connecting gear connected to the end of the transmission rod penetrating the functional frame, a seeder fixedly mounted to one end of the functional frame, and a transmission gear fixedly connected to the power input end of the seeder, and a transmission chain connecting the transmission gear and the connecting gear, the connecting gear being rotatably connected to the functional frame; A mounting plate is provided on one side of the mounting frame, and the mounting plate is fixedly installed to the mounting frame by locking bolts. Locking plates are engaged at the upper and lower ends of the mounting plate, and locking posts are fixedly provided on the outer surface of the two locking plates facing each other. A rotating center rod is installed in the center of the outer surface of the mounting plate, and a sliding plate is provided inside one end of the center rod. A rotating rod is installed at one end of the sliding plate. A limit block is fixedly provided on the outer surface of the mounting plate.

[0005] Preferably, the shaft section of the transmission rod is hexagonal, and the transmission rod and the connecting gear are slidably connected.

[0006] By adopting the above technical solution, the transmission rod 6 can maintain relative sliding with the connecting gear 7 when it slides and adjusts its position with the functional frame 5, and can also stably transmit torque through its hexagonal cross section, thus ensuring the continuity and reliability of power transmission.

[0007] Preferably, the locking plate is engaged with the positioning hole via a locking post, and the locking post is located on both sides of the locking bolt.

[0008] By adopting the above technical solution, the horizontal position of the functional frame 5 can be quickly and accurately fixed by engaging the locking post 14 with the positioning holes 3 at different positions, thereby realizing flexible adjustment and firm locking of the sowing row spacing. The structure is simple and reliable.

[0009] Preferably, the longitudinal section of the central rod is T-shaped, and the central rod and the sliding plate are slidably connected.

[0010] By adopting the above technical solution, the T-shaped design of the central rod 15 facilitates manual rotation operation, and its sliding connection with the sliding plate 16 provides a structural basis for the subsequent rotation-driven locking mechanism.

[0011] Preferably, the sliding plate and the rotating rod are concentrically arranged, and the rotating rod and the center rod are clearance-fitted, with a spring connecting the sliding plate and the center rod.

[0012] Using the above technical solution, the spring provides the restoring force of the sliding plate 16, ensuring that the rotating rod 17 and the limiting block 18 remain in contact to lock the position in the non-adjustment state. The clearance fit ensures the smooth rotation of the rotating rod 17, thereby realizing the synchronous opening and closing of the locking plates 13 on both sides by rotating the central rod 15.

[0013] Preferably, the rotating rod is T-shaped, and both ends of the rotating rod are respectively attached to the opposite ends of the two locking plates.

[0014] By adopting the above technical solution, both ends of the T-shaped rotating rod 17 can act on the upper and lower locking plates 13 simultaneously, ensuring that when the center rod 15 is rotated, the two locking plates 13 can be driven to move synchronously in opposite directions, realizing fast and synchronous locking and releasing functions, and making operation simple.

[0015]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are: the adjustable spacing vegetable sowing device: 1. The device uses a sliding functional frame and a mounting frame with positioning holes to allow the position of the seeder relative to the self-propelled frame to be adjusted laterally. This design allows users to flexibly change the row spacing according to the agronomic requirements of different vegetable varieties, effectively solving the problems of fixed row spacing and poor adaptability of traditional seeders. The locking plate, locking post and positioning hole are connected by a simple and reliable structure, which can ensure that the functional frame is firmly locked during operation, ensuring the stability of the row spacing and the accuracy of the sowing. 2. A hexagonal transmission rod is used, which can reliably transmit torque while slidingly connecting with the connecting gear. When the position of the functional frame changes, the transmission path formed by the transmission chain between the transmission rod, the connecting gear and the transmission gear remains stable, ensuring continuous and effective power transmission from the self-propelled frame to the seeder, and avoiding the problem of transmission failure due to spacing adjustment. 3. By rotating the central rod, the sliding plate and rotating rod can be driven to move, which can drive the locking plates on both sides to separate or close synchronously, thereby quickly completing the locking and releasing of the functional frame. This centralized control operation method significantly simplifies the adjustment steps, saves time and effort, and greatly facilitates users to quickly adjust the sowing configuration in the field according to actual needs, improving the practicality and operational efficiency of the equipment. [0020] Example 1: This example discloses: a self-propelled power frame 1, a mounting frame 2 fixedly connected to the lower end of one side of the self-propelled power frame 1, positioning holes 3 evenly opened on the outer surface of the mounting frame 2, displacement wheels 4 fixedly installed on the outer surface of the mounting frame 2, and a sliding functional frame 5 installed on the outer surface of the mounting frame 2, a transmission rod 6 fixedly connected to the power output end of the self-propelled power frame 1, one end of the transmission rod 6 penetrating the outer surface of the functional frame 5, and a connecting gear 7 connected to the end of the transmission rod 6 penetrating the functional frame 5, a seeder 10 fixedly installed at one end of the functional frame 5, and a transmission gear 8 fixedly connected to the power input end of the seeder 10, and a transmission chain 9 connected between the transmission gear 8 and the connecting gear 7, and the connecting gear 7 being rotatably connected to the functional frame 5; The shaft section of the transmission rod 6 is hexagonal, and the transmission rod 6 and the connecting gear 7 are slidably connected. The self-propelled motor 1 provides power, which drives the entire device to move via the displacement wheel 4. The torque is transmitted through the hexagonal transmission rod 6 at its output end. The functional frame 5 is slidably mounted on the mounting frame 2. By sliding the functional frame 5, the lateral position of the seeder 10 fixed at one end can be changed, thereby adjusting the sowing row spacing. The transmission rod 6 is slidably connected to the connecting gear 7 on the functional frame 5. When the functional frame 5 moves, the connecting gear 7 moves accordingly and transmits power to the transmission gear 8 fixed at the power input end of the seeder 10 via the transmission chain 9. This design ensures that the power transmission from the self-propelled motor 1 to the seeder 10 remains connected and effective after the position of the seeder 10 is adjusted.

[0021] Example 2: This example is based on Example 1: A mounting plate 11 is provided on one side of the mounting frame 2, and the mounting plate 11 is fixedly installed to the mounting frame 2 by locking bolts 12. Locking plates 13 are engaged at the upper and lower ends of the mounting plate 11, and locking posts 14 are fixedly provided on the outer surface of the two locking plates 13 facing each other. A rotating center rod 15 is installed in the center of the outer surface of the mounting plate 11, and a sliding plate 16 is provided inside one end of the center rod 15. A rotating rod 17 is installed on one end of the sliding plate 16. A limit block 18 is fixedly provided on the outer surface of the mounting plate 11. The locking plate 13 is engaged with the positioning hole 3 via the locking pin 14, and the locking pin 14 is located on both sides of the locking bolt 12; The longitudinal section of the center rod 15 is T-shaped, and the center rod 15 and the sliding plate 16 are slidably connected. The sliding plate 16 and the rotating rod 17 are concentrically arranged, and the rotating rod 17 and the center rod 15 are clearance-fitted. A spring connects the sliding plate 16 and the center rod 15. The rotating rod 17 has a T-shaped design, and both ends of the rotating rod 17 are respectively attached to the opposite ends of the two locking plates 13; The upper and lower ends of the mounting plate 11 are engaged with locking plates 13, and locking pins 14 are fixed on the locking plates 13. In the locked state, the locking pins 14 will be engaged in the positioning holes 3 on the mounting bracket 2, thereby fixing the position of the functional bracket 5. When the row spacing needs to be adjusted, pull and rotate the rotating rod 17 in the center of the outer surface of the mounting plate 11, so that the rotating rod 17 disengages from the contact with the limiting block 18. The rotating rod 17 drives the sliding plate 16 inside the center rod 15 to slide and stretch the spring between the center rod 15. When the rotating rod 17 rotates, the two ends of the T-shape are respectively in contact with the upper and lower locking plates 13. Its movement will drive the two locking plates 13 to move synchronously in opposite directions, so that the locking pin 14 disengages from the positioning hole 3, thereby releasing the functional frame 5. After adjusting the position, rotate the center rod 15 in the opposite direction and press the locking plate 13, so that the locking pin 14 is inserted into the new positioning hole 3, and the locking is quickly completed. At this time, the rotating rod 17 will not rotate due to the obstruction of the limiting block 18 during the operation, causing the locking plate 13 to slide under pressure. The locking bolt 12 ensures that the mounting plate 11 remains stable in the installation of the functional frame 5.
